Lightbulb Re: 87 GN -- Made in Canada??

Quote:
Originally Posted by mapearso
1) Were there cars made in or for export to Canada?
Yes, made in Pontiac Michigan (just like all other Regals, and maybe all other G-bodies of the era) and exported to Canada and several other countries. (Finland, UK, Scotland, etc.) Look for the PON code on the RPO sticker.
Quote:
Originally Posted by mapearso
2) I assume since the speedo shows Km/H that the mileage on the car is also in Kilometers?
Yes. The odometer rolls over more frequently since it is only five digits, unfortunately.
Quote:
Originally Posted by mapearso
3) Anyone have one of these cars? Is there anything particular I should be aware of?
Production of the foreign destination cars was lower than the US cars. Other than that, not much.
